Revolution Still In The Hunt For A New Soccer-Specific Stadium

Revolution President Brian Bilello last weekend "offered some reassurance that the hunt remains very much alive" for building a new soccer-specific stadium for the team, according to Jon Chesto of the BOSTON GLOBE. A team spokesperson "confirmed that the Kraft Group is now willing to invest" as much as $400M in a roughly 20,000-seat venue. Chesto: "The location? Sorry, everyone. That remains a mystery." Should the stadium project happen, it "appears almost certain that it will eclipse" Gillette Stadium in terms of "construction costs." The Krafts "spent roughly" $350M to open Gillette Stadium in '02. The "biggest variable" the Kraft family faces is "real estate." The Krafts "want to give Revs players and their fans a more intimate experience," and they "hope moving the games out of suburban Foxborough and into an urban setting can draw more attendees" (BOSTON GLOBE, 4/27).
